Cutting Aluminium with a Machine Upcut Saw

To effectively cut the metal profiles, a powered upcut saw is often the preferred choice. These saws use a saw tooth designed to remove chips upwards, which prevents the clogging that can impede cutting performance, especially with thin aluminum. A stable feed rate is vital to produce clean, smooth surfaces and avoid the potential of damage. Proper alignment and fluid are also important for maximum results and longer tool longevity.

Picking your Correct Compound Saw {for | dealing with Aluminum Processing

When dealing with metal for intricate machining , choosing the appropriate miter saw is critical . Different from wood, aluminum presents unique issues due to its tendency to deform and generate a edge . Therefore , consider a machine with a fine-tooth blade specifically designed for non-ferrous components, and review features like material removal and the strong motor to guarantee clean, precise cuts .
